Output e5b52ad090afd7665790aa2d8aeb6947bc9ce038f1bb73223764dfaa1135c89e:0

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b0a0baffc0a9a42a99a17a87c54943be7b8bb97 OP_EQUAL
address
39zPSz4TSt9RsHUue1kBnSYa7c4Q1nFfV4
transaction
e5b52ad090afd7665790aa2d8aeb6947bc9ce038f1bb73223764dfaa1135c89e
spent
true